Warwickshire Lead Wiped Out

Last updated : 10 June 2014 By Covsupport News Service

Warwickshire County Cricket Club had their first innings lead wiped out on the third day of their County Championship game with Lancashire at Edgbaston.

Warwicks resumed on 130-4 but quickly lost Will Porterfield who added only six runs to his over night total of 51.

Tim Ambrose and Rikki Clarke came to the crease and had put on 97 when Ambrose was trapped lbw by Hogg after making 62.

Rikki Clarke made 56 but he was bowled by Simon Kerrigan and this was followed by Patal,Wright and Rankin all losing their wickets cheaply whilst at the other end, Keith Barker batted on for an unbeaten 44.

Lancashire had made 71 in their second innings when Warwicks got a break through with Jeetan Patal trapping Davies, who had made thirty lbw.

His fellow opener Paul Horton, followed twelve runs later, when he was caught behind by Tim Ambrose to give Boyd Rankin a wicket as Lancs closed on 84-2, some 48 runs ahead.
